原文:清除行内元素之间HTML空白的几种解决方案

行内块 inline block 是非常有用的,特别是想要不用 block 和 float 来控制这些行内元素的margin,padding之时。问题来了,HTML源码中行内元素之间的空白有时候显示在屏幕上那是相当的讨厌。当然,有一些技巧 方法 可以用来清除他们:比如粗暴地完全删除空白,或者其他的方法: 解决方案 : font size: 最好的方法是在外层元素上设置font size: 同时在内 ...

2015-10-20 00:00 0 1761 推荐指数:

查看详情

行内元素之间产生水平间隙的原因及解决方案

1. 行内元素之间产生水平空隙的原因:代码中有意或无意的添加了换行符,tab(制表符)或者空格等字符引起的; 2. 解决方案: 删除引起问题的换行符,制表符或者空格等,但是缺点是会使代码结构混乱; 设置margin属性为负数,如:margin-left: -3px;缺点是负数的值 ...

Wed Sep 13 19:21:00 CST 2017 0 1770
解决行内元素(inline-block)之间的空格或空白问题

一、问题产生 由于html代码格式化后,标签会缩进或者换行。由于浏览器默认处理导致元素在页面显示中出现单个空格问题,尤其在行内或者行内元素布局时影响比较明显 例如: 代码 页面显示 二、解决方案 这种问题出现让人很头疼,寻访答案却都差强人意 ...

Tue Oct 01 06:16:00 CST 2019 0 566
空白符对HTML结构的影响与解决方案

何为空白符? 空白符: 空格、制表符、换行符 注意:浏览器在解析HTML时会把所有空白符合并成一个空格 空白符对HTML结构的影响 HTML5中<textarea>标签placeholder无法正确显示 不好的结构造成意外的结果: 标签换行了: 标签之间 ...

Tue Jul 04 20:08:00 CST 2017 0 1406
HTML行内元素之间的空格问题

HTML行内元素之间的空格问题 1.为什么元素之间会产生空格? 在编写行内元素(包括inline-block元素)的代码之间如果有空格(换行),在浏览器上就会显示元素之间有空格。 示例代码如下: 浏览器运行结果: 注意: 不管我们在元素之间敲如多少空格 ...

Thu Dec 23 01:42:00 CST 2021 0 91
html行内元素之间的缝隙

关于html行内元素之间缝隙的那点儿事情 事情是这样子的,我起初打算验证使用transform属性的标签是否会影响其他的标签的布局,于是写了下面一段代码: 结果呢也还算能接受: 但是,我发现了另外一个问题: 这之间的缝隙是什么东东?琢磨了好久也不知道。希望读者中有知道的麻烦评论 ...

Thu Aug 27 18:24:00 CST 2020 4 368
inline-block元素间距问题的几种解决方案

   不知道大家有没有碰到过设置了display:inline-block;的几个相邻元素之间有几px间距的问题,这里提供几种简单实用的解决方法,希望能够帮到大家!    方法1. 将<li>标签之间的空格与换行全部去掉,这也是我比较常用的一种 ...

Thu Dec 22 05:16:00 CST 2016 0 2065
同一DIV内,两个行内元素不对齐的解决方案

这个跟基线对齐有关系,如果你给写文字的那个span设置一个vertical-align:top,就可以对齐,具体原因如下:从CSS2的可视化格式模型文档中可以看到:inline-block的基线是正常 ...

Fri Dec 22 19:21:00 CST 2017 0 5357
 
粤ICP备18138465号  © 2018-2026 CODEPRJ.COM